Welcome to La Papaya Deli, a delightful haven located at 3347 E Russell Rd, Las Vegas, NV 89120. Known for its vibrant atmosphere and mouthwatering offerings, this deli encapsulates the essence of fresh, wholesome food with a twist of Latin flair. Whether you are a local or just visiting Las Vegas, La Papaya Deli has quickly become a go-to spot for delicious bites and refreshing drinks.

The menu at La Papaya Deli is an adventurous combination of traditional and newfound favorites. Tortas, a signature offering, showcase a range of delectable options. The Pork Torta comes topped with layers of shredded pork, creamy mayonnaise, and fresh vegetables, all for just $10.99. Meanwhile, their Cuban Torta packs a punch with ham, turkey, and a medley of flavors that will entice your taste buds for only $11.99. Vegetarian options and breakfast selections are abundant as well, with all-day breakfast that features delightful creations like the Avocado Omelette and hearty Breakfast Burrito.

This is a great, quick healthy spot! I'm so happy to have found fresh squeezed juices and smoothies so close to me. They have a ton of produce on hand that goes straight into the food they create. 5 stars for juice and smoothies. As for sandwiches, I find the chicken to be a bit manufactured and not likely top quality. Taste and flavor is great, but these options aren't as fresh as some others. Salad was unique as they use salsa you might find traditionally for tacos as a salad topping. They give pickled jalapenos with it too. Interesting twist, not complaining but not something I've seen before. Deserts, big spot for this. You'll find the patrons are there for healthy food or all the desserts, including families and couples sharing huge sweet treats. Friendly to spanish speakers, seems independently run and very friendly and helpful to everyone who comes in. I recommend this place if you are healthy or unhealthy, something for everyone!
